作 者:黄国洋 Huang Guoyang(Belt and Road Environmental Technology Exchange and Transfer Center(Shenzhen),Shenzhen 518100,China)
机构地区:[1]一带一路环境技术交流与转移中心(深圳),广东深圳518100
出 处:《皮革制作与环保科技》2024年第23期119-121,共3页Leather Manufacture and Environmental Technology
摘 要:随着全球环境污染的加剧,挥发性有机化合物(VOC)的深度治理变得尤为关键。本文综述了当前VOC治理技术的发展现状,包括常用的吸附、吸收、光催化和生物净化技术,并指出了各种技术在实际应用中面临的技术局限性和经济挑战。通过分析国内外的法规与政策现状,探讨了推动VOC深度治理的政策机制。本文还提出了一系列面向可持续发展的治理策略,并通过案例分析验证了这些策略的实际效果。With the intensification of global environmental pollution,the in-depth treatment of volatile organic compounds(VOCs)has become particularly critical.This paper summarizes the current development status of VOC treatment technologies,inclu ding commonly used adsorption,absorption,photocatalytic and biological purification technologies,and points out the technical limitations and economic challenges faced by each technology in practical application.By analyzing the current status of regulations and policies at home and abroad,the policy mechanism to promote the deep treatment of VOC is discussed.A series of governance strategies oriented to sustainable development are also proposed,and the practical effects of these strategies are verified through case studies.
关 键 词:VOC治理 生态环境 可持续发展 技术创新 政策机制
